After a tooth extraction, many people ponder the right time to get a dental implant. Dental implants provide a permanent solution for missing teeth, restoring each operate and aesthetics. However, the timing between extraction and implant placement can range relying on a quantity of components.


Generally, the bone surrounding the extracted tooth requires time to heal before an implant could be placed. The body needs to endure a healing course of, and this will take a couple of weeks to a quantity of months. The specific timeframe is influenced by the condition of the bone and the type of extraction performed.




In easy extractions where the tooth was seen and easily removed, sufferers may find a way to obtain an implant sooner. However, in instances of difficult extractions, similar to these involving impacted teeth or important bone loss, an extended healing interval may be necessary.


After extraction, the initial therapeutic part normally lasts about one to 2 weeks. During this period, a blood clot forms within the extraction web site, which is crucial for therapeutic. Once the delicate tissue has healed adequately, the subsequent step is to gauge the bone's condition.

For individuals who have healthy bone density, an implant can often be positioned as quickly as the extraction website is sufficiently healed, which could be round two to 3 months after extraction. This timeframe allows for delicate tissue therapeutic and the stabilization of the world, making it appropriate for implant insertion.

Patients with present bone loss might require extra procedures, such as bone grafting, to arrange the positioning for an implant. Bone grafting includes including bone material to the world to advertise new bone growth, which ensures that the implant has a powerful foundation. This process additionally extends the overall timeline for the reason that grafted bone requires its personal therapeutic time, typically a quantity of months.


In circumstances where quick implants are possible, some dentists might select to position an implant immediately after tooth extraction. This method can minimize the overall therapy time because it combines each procedures. Immediate implants usually are not appropriate for everyone, and the choice will rely upon elements such because the health of the gum tissue and the quality of the bone.


Consultation with a dentist is crucial to determine essentially the most correct timeline for dental implants following tooth extraction. Dentists sometimes conduct a thorough examination, possibly together with X-rays or 3D imaging, to evaluate the bone structure. These assessments guide the dentist in planning the most effective plan of action.

Another factor influencing the timing for dental implants is the patient’s total health. Conditions corresponding to uncontrolled diabetes or other systemic health issues may necessitate a longer ready period. Healing capability varies among people, and factors like smoking or poor oral hygiene can even affect recovery time and the success rate of implants.

Once the dental implant is positioned, the subsequent stage is osseointegration, where the implant fuses with the jawbone. This process is significant because it provides stability and power to the implant. Osseointegration can take a quantity of months, often four to six months, before the final crown can be attached. The timeline may range relying on the person's therapeutic ability and different factors.

    How long after tooth extraction are you able to get a dental implant?





How long should I wait after a tooth extraction before getting a dental implant?undefinedIt's typically suggested to wait between three to six months after a tooth extraction earlier than getting a dental implant. This interval allows for adequate therapeutic of the bone and gums.


Can I get a dental implant right after tooth extraction?undefinedIn some instances, instant implants can be positioned right after extraction, but this is determined by factors like the condition of the bone and gum tissue. A thorough analysis by your dentist is crucial.

What components have an result on the healing time after tooth extraction?undefinedFactors corresponding to age, general health, oral hygiene, and the complexity of the extraction can affect healing time. A healthier physique and good habits usually lead to quicker recovery.

Are there any issues that would extend the ready interval for a dental implant?undefinedYes, complications similar to infection, dry socket, or poor bone density can prolong the ready interval. Proper post-operative care is crucial to keep away from these points.


Can bone grafting have an effect on the timeline for getting a dental implant?undefinedIf bone grafting is critical as a result of inadequate bone density, it could add several months to the timeline. It typically takes about 4 to six months for the graft to combine before implant placement.


What are the signs that my extraction site is healing properly?undefinedSigns of correct healing embody reduced swelling, less pain, closed extraction web site, and no signs of infection corresponding to pus or extended bleeding. Regular follow-ups together with your dentist are recommended.
